XL 6009 Automatic Buck-Boost Converter for Voltage Regulation & Power Projects
The XL6009 DC-DC Adjustable Boost-Buck Converter Module is a versatile power module designed to step up (boost) or step down (buck) input voltage to a stable, adjustable output. It is widely used in DIY electronics, battery-powered systems, solar applications, and embedded projects where voltage regulation is required.
Unlike simple boost or buck modules, this module operates as a buck-boost converter, meaning the output voltage can be higher or lower than the input voltage depending on the requirement.
Based on the XL6009 switching regulator IC, it uses high-frequency switching (~400kHz) to achieve compact size, high efficiency (~94%), and up to 4A output current.
The onboard multi-turn potentiometer allows precise output voltage adjustment, making it ideal for prototyping and real-world power applications.

Specifications
- IC Chip: XL6009
- Type: Non-isolated DC-DC buck-boost converter
- Input Voltage: 3.8V – 32V
- Output Voltage: 1.25V – 35V (adjustable)
- Output Current: Up to 4A
- Efficiency: Up to ~94%
- Switching Frequency: ~400kHz
- Mounting: PCB module with screw terminals

How to Use
- Connect input supply to IN+ / IN-
- Connect load to OUT+ / OUT-
- Rotate potentiometer to adjust output voltage
- Measure output using a multimeter before connecting sensitive loads
